South Africa national cricket team captain Aiden Markram won the toss and chose to bat against India national cricket team in their T20 World Cup Super Eight match in Ahmedabad. India kept the same XI that played against the Netherlands. Captain Suryakumar Yadav said it was “very harsh on Axar Patel” but confirmed there were no changes. South Africa made four changes. David Miller, Marco Jansen, Keshav Maharaj and Lungi Ngidi returned to the side. Markram said, “Really a good wicket and lot drier than what we have seen.” The match is at the Narendra Modi Stadium.
